2006/07 Fixtures Announced

Last updated : 22 June 2006 By Matthew Jones
The fixtures for the new 2006/07 season have been announced today.

Due to copyright protection, the fixture list cannot be published on this article, but here are a few of the fixtures which stand out for the coming season.

Tranmere will open the season on 5th August at home to Oldham Athletic, meaning Ronnie Moore will begin his term as Tranmere manager against the club he managed last season.

Rovers first away game will be newly promoted Cheltenham on Tuesday 8th August whilst Tranmere will face Millwall away on April 14th.

Over Christmas, Rovers will play Gillingham at home on 23rd December, then Huddersfield and Nottingham Forest on Boxing Day and 28th December away from home, before returning to Prenton Park on New Years Day against Rotherham for the second year running.

Rovers will play Brentford at home as their final game of the season whilst their final away game will be Crewe on 28th April.
